BÁO cáo bài tập lớn môn kỹ THUẬT VI sử lý

5 278 0
BÁO cáo bài tập lớn môn kỹ THUẬT VI sử lý

Đang tải... (xem toàn văn)

Thông tin tài liệu

Hiện nay, tình trạng tắc nghẽn giao thông còn nhiều. Do đó, nhóm em có ý tưởng thực hiện mô phỏng đèn giao thông trên đường tại các nơi giao nhau ở ngã tư và ngã ba. Nhóm sử dụng vi điều khiển 8051để nghiên cứu và mô phỏng quá trình hoạt động của đèn giao thông, đồng thời đưa ra một số đề xuất về chức năng của đèn giao thông để giảm thiểu tình trạng giao thông trên. Mạch thực hiện đếm lùi, số đếm được hiển thị qua Led 7 đoạn. Khi mạch thực hiện đếm lùi , 3 Led đỏ, xanh và vàng sẽ lần lượt sáng biểu thị cho cột đèn giao thông . Mạch có thể áp dụng cho nhiều đèn giao thông ở ngã tư và ngã ba có các tuyến đường cắt nhau. Mạch có chức năng điều tiết lưu lượng giao thông, khi lượng xe lưu thông của tuyến đường không đều

BÁO CÁO BÀI TẬP LỚN MÔN KỸ THUẬT VI XỬ LÝ MẠCH MÔ PHỎNG ĐÈN GIAO THÔNG Giảng viên hướng dẫn: Cao Văn Nam Môn : Kỹ Thuật Vi Xử Lý Sinh viên thực hiên: Lê Văn Bảo Võ Thị Hoàng Anh Nguyễn Hoàng Anh Lớp : ĐHVT3A Khoa : KTVT I > Ý TƯỞNG THỰC HIỆN: Hiện nay, tình trạng tắc nghẽn giao thơng nhiều Do đó, nhóm em có ý tưởng thực mơ đèn giao thông đường nơi giao ngã tư ngã ba Nhóm sử dụng vi điều khiển 8051để nghiên cứu mơ q trình hoạt động đèn giao thông, đồng thời đưa số đề xuất chức đèn giao thông để giảm thiểu tình trạng giao thơng II> CHỨC NĂNG CỦA MẠCH: Mạch thực đếm lùi, số đếm hiển thị qua Led đoạn Khi mạch thực đếm lùi , Led đỏ, xanh vàng sáng biểu thị cho cột đèn giao thông Mạch áp dụng cho nhiều đèn giao thơng ngã tư ngã ba có tuyến đường cắt Mạch có chức điều tiết lưu lượng giao thông, lượng xe lưu thông tuyến đường không III> LINH KIỆN LÀM MẠCH: - Vi điều khiển 8051 - Led đỏ, xanh, vàng số lượng loại - Điện trỏ 220Ω - Tụ thạch anh 12Mhz, tụ 33pF - Led đoạn loại 7SEG-MPX2-CA - Nguồn 5V IV> NGUYÊN LÝ HOẠT ĐỘNG: Mô tả mạch: Cực âm Led Xanh nối điện trở 220 ôm nối với cổng P0.0 , cực âm Led Vàng nối điện trở 220 ôm nối với cổng P0.3, cực âm Led Đỏ nối điện trở 220 ôm nối với cổng P0.6 vi điều khiển, cực dương Led Xanh, Vàng Đỏ nối chung với nối với nguồn dương 5V Các chân A,B,C,D,E,F,G Led đoạn nối với điện trở 220 ôm nối với chân PORT vi điều khiển P2.0, P2.1, P2.2, P2.3, P2.4, P2.5 P2.6 Chân P3.0 P3.1 vi điều khiển nối với chân nguồn 1,2 Led đoạn Nguyên lý làm việc: Ban đầu mạch hoạt động, Led đoạn hiển thị 20 (tương ứng 20 giây) đồng thời Led Xanh sáng, tương ứng với tín hiệu đèn xanh cột đèn giao thông, đồng thời Led đoạn đếm lùi từ 20 trở 00 Kế tiếp, Led đoạn hiển thị 05 (tương ứng 05 giây) đồng thời Led Vàng sáng, tương ứng với tín hiệu đèn vàng , đồng thời Led đoạn đếm lùi 00 Cuối Led đoạn hiển thị 20 (tương ứng 20 giây) đồng Led Đỏ sáng, tương ứng với tín hiệu đèn đỏ, đồng thời Led đoạn đếm lùi 00 Sau , mạch lặp lại chu trình ban đầu V> CODE : #include void delay(int time) { while(time ); int dem; } char i; unsigned char chuc, donvi; char so[]={0x40,0x79,0x24,0x30,0x19,0x12,0x02,0x78,0x00,0x10}; void ledxanhdo() { P3_0 = P3_1 = 0; for(dem=20;dem>=0;dem ) { chuc = dem/10; donvi = dem%10; for(i=0;i=0;dem ) { chuc = dem/10; donvi = dem%10; for(i=0;i MẠCH MÔ PHỎNG TRÊN PROTEUS: ... điều khiển P2.0, P2.1, P2.2, P2.3, P2.4, P2.5 P2.6 Chân P3.0 P3.1 vi điều khiển nối với chân nguồn 1,2 Led đoạn Nguyên lý làm vi c: Ban đầu mạch hoạt động, Led đoạn hiển thị 20 (tương ứng 20 giây)... LINH KIỆN LÀM MẠCH: - Vi điều khiển 8051 - Led đỏ, xanh, vàng số lượng loại - Điện trỏ 220Ω - Tụ thạch anh 12Mhz, tụ 33pF - Led đoạn loại 7SEG-MPX2-CA - Nguồn 5V IV> NGUYÊN LÝ HOẠT ĐỘNG: Mô tả... nối với cổng P0.6 vi điều khiển, cực dương Led Xanh, Vàng Đỏ nối chung với nối với nguồn dương 5V Các chân A,B,C,D,E,F,G Led đoạn nối với điện trở 220 ôm nối với chân PORT vi điều khiển P2.0,

Ngày đăng: 29/09/2019, 23:41

Từ khóa liên quan

Mục lục

  • I > Ý TƯỞNG THỰC HIỆN:

  • Hiện nay, tình trạng tắc nghẽn giao thông còn nhiều. Do đó, nhóm em có ý tưởng thực hiện mô phỏng đèn giao thông trên đường tại các nơi giao nhau ở ngã tư và ngã ba. Nhóm sử dụng vi điều khiển 8051để nghiên cứu và mô phỏng quá trình hoạt động của đèn...

  • II> CHỨC NĂNG CỦA MẠCH:

  • IV> NGUYÊN LÝ HOẠT ĐỘNG:

  • Mô tả mạch:

  • Cực âm Led Xanh nối điện trở 220 ôm và nối với cổng P0.0 , cực âm Led Vàng nối điện trở 220 ôm và nối với cổng P0.3, cực âm Led Đỏ nối điện trở 220 ôm và nối với cổng P0.6 của vi điều khiển, cực dương các Led Xanh, Vàng và Đỏ được nối chung với nhau v...

  • Các chân A,B,C,D,E,F,G của Led 7 đoạn được nối với điện trở 220 ôm và nối với các chân của PORT 2 vi điều khiển lần lượt P2.0, P2.1, P2.2, P2.3, P2.4, P2.5 và P2.6. Chân P3.0 và P3.1 của vi điều khiển nối với 2 chân nguồn lần lượt 1,2 của Led 7 đoạn.

  • Nguyên lý làm việc:

  • Ban đầu khi mạch hoạt động, Led 7 đoạn hiển thị 20 (tương ứng 20 giây) đồng thời Led Xanh sẽ sáng, tương ứng với tín hiệu đèn xanh ở cột đèn giao thông, đồng thời Led 7 đoạn sẽ đếm lùi từ 20 trở về 00.

  • Kế tiếp, Led 7 đoạn hiển thị 05 (tương ứng 05 giây) đồng thời Led Vàng sẽ sáng, tương ứng với tín hiệu đèn vàng , đồng thời Led 7 đoạn sẽ đếm lùi về 00.

  • Cuối cùng Led 7 đoạn hiển thị 20 (tương ứng 20 giây) đồng Led Đỏ sẽ sáng, tương ứng với tín hiệu đèn đỏ, đồng thời Led 7 đoạn sẽ đếm lùi về 00. Sau đó , mạch lặp lại chu trình ban đầu.

  • V> CODE :

  • #include <REGX51.H>

  • void delay(int time)

  • { while(time--); }

  • int dem; char i;

  • unsigned char chuc, donvi;

  • char so[]={0x40,0x79,0x24,0x30,0x19,0x12,0x02,0x78,0x00,0x10};

  • void ledxanhdo()

  • { P3_0 = P3_1 = 0;

Tài liệu cùng người dùng

Tài liệu liên quan